The concept >>>> of a peripheral ID is introduced, and all peripheral clock access is done >>>> using this ID. >>>> >>>> Functions are provided to start, query and adjust peripheral clocks, >>>> including automatic selection of the best available clock based on the >>>> requested rate (this replaces hard-coded divisors). >>>> >>>> On the pinmux side we can now select functions for pin groups using the >>>> new pinmux_set_func() function. >>>> >>>> Expanded functions are provided to adjust and query PLL clocks. >>>> >>>> With a full compliment of clock and pinmux functions, it should no longer >>>> be necessary for board/driver code to directly access clock registers. >>>> This >>>> change removes all such accesses. >>>> >>>> This functionality will be used for I2C, SPI, LCD, USB, keyboard, NAND >>>> and >>>> other drivers for Tegra2. >>>> >>>> At then end is a patch to enable MMC on Seaboard, to make it all >>>> worthwhile. >>>> >>>> Note: These patches include a definition of assert() which I will happily >>>> remove if the one sent upstream is accepted. >>>> >>>> Changes in v2: >>>> - Remove assert() which is now in common.h >>>> >>>> Simon Glass (6): >>>> tegra2: Rename CLOCK_PLL_ID to CLOCK_ID >>>> tegra2: Clean up board code a little >>>> tegra2: Add more clock functions >>>> tegra2: Rename PIN_ to PINGRP_ >>>> tegra2: Add more pinmux functions >>>> tegra2: Enable MMC for Seaboard >>> >>> Are these ready to apply, do you think? >> >> They would appear to.
